Quaker bought Snapple for $1.7 billion in 1994 and sold it to Triarc in 1997 for $300 million. Triarc sold it to Cadbury Schweppes for $1.45 billion in September 2000. In 1983, Quaker bought Stokely-Van Camp, Inc., makers of Van Camp's and Gatorade. Quaker bought Snapple for $1.7 billion in 1994 and sold it to Triarc in 1997 for $300 million. Triarc sold it to Cadbury Schweppes for $1.45 billion in September 2000. Lee purchased Snapple from its founders for $140 million. Two years later he sold it to Quaker Oats for $1.7 billion. Less than 3 years later, after investing additional hundreds of millions on the brand, Quaker sold it for $300 million.

Quaker Oats only owned Snapple for 27 months, selling it for $300 million after making a $1.7 billion investment in the drinks company.
